Corsair Cove is a Steam city-building strategy game by Limbic Entertainment and Hooded Horse. Build a sprawling pirate haven, manage production chains and a rowdy crew, assemble a fleet, and face the Crown on the high seas.

Check the guide →Corsair Cove left its pre-release window and launched as the public 1.0 base game on Steam. The store identifies the release date as 2026-07-31 and lists the developer as Limbic Entertainment and the publisher as Hooded Horse. For players, this milestone is the reference point for building connections, resources, Crew and Cohesion, ships, the Compass, and the published system requirements. Those systems should be read as 1.0 behavior unless a later official note identifies a change. The release also separates base-game support from Demo history. A player troubleshooting the retail installation should report AppID 1368140 and should not assume a Demo update title or Demo BuildID identifies the same files. Corsair Cove is a Steam simulation and strategy game in which you build a pirate haven, manage complex production chains and crew, construct a fleet, explore the high seas, and fight the Crown.
The official Steam page lists Limbic Entertainment as developer and Hooded Horse as publisher.
The official Steam page lists a release date of July 31, 2026.
